Phonecell ® SX5D Fixed Wireless F·A·X Phone • Voice • GPRS Packet Data • Circuit Switched Data • Short Message Service (SMS) • Group 3 Analog Fax • Circuit Switched Computer Fax Also Featuring Access the Internet and E-Mail Dual RJ-11 connections for multiple extensions Automatic end-of-dialing (no SEND key) Caller ID, call waiting/call hold, call forwarding Speakerphone Large, easy to read LCD PC keyboard can be attached for text messaging Easy set up Models • Dual Band 900/1800 GSM Phase 2+ • Single Band 1900 GSM Phase 2+ Compact design for voice, data, FAX AND MULTIPLE EXTENSIONS (F·A·X) Fixed Wireless F·A·X Phone Features •GPRS packet data, multi-slot Class 10 (up to 85.6 kbps)* •Circuit switched digital computer fax and data (up to 14.4 kbps)* •Short Message Service (SMS)* • Group 3 analog fax* •Compatible with popular supplementary services including caller ID, call waiting/call hold, call forwarding, call barring, multi-party calling, and more* • DTMF keypad with half duplex speakerphone, mute, redial and flash • Fully pixilated LCD display for text messaging, phone book, set up, signal-strength indication, etc. • Soft key access to menu, voice mail, SMS and phone book • Speed dial • Volume control and configurable rings per service •Call logs, clock and call timer • Extensive security control features •Built-in signal-strength indication • Single jack or dual jack for voice and fax operation •DTMF and pulse-dialing •Automatic end-of-dialing (no SEND key) •Supports up to five phones (5 REN) • Emergency battery backup • Simple desktop or wall-mount installation •Standard GSM Mini-SIM (Subscriber Identification Module) 3 volt and 5 volt compatible • Supports SIM Application Toolkit •Supports GSM personalization features (GSM 02.22) Connectivity Options Models •Dual Band 900/1800 GSM Phase 2+ •Single Band 1900 GSM Phase 2+ Specifications Air Interface Standard • GSM 900/1800 Phase 2+ • GSM 1900 TIA/EIA J-STD-007 PCS 1900 Transmit Power • GSM 900: 2 watts • GSM 1800: 1 watt • GSM 1900: 1 watt Frequency Ranges TransmitReceive •GSM 900890-915 MHz935-960 MHz •GSM 18001710-1785 MHz1805-1880 MHz •GSM 19001850-1910 MHz1930-1990 MHz FWT Dimensions and Weight • Metric (cm) 18.3 x 5.1 x 21.1 • U.S. (inches) 7.2 x 2.0 x 8.3 • 0.73 kg. (1.6 lb.) Environment • Operating temperature range: -10°C to +50°C • Storage temperature range: -40°C to + 60°C • Humidity: 5% to 95% Intelligent RJ-11 Interface • Ringer equivalence number (REN) 5.0A • Dynamic echo cancellation • PSTN Emulation LCD Display • Resolution: 64 pixels high x 132 pixels long • Characters: Icons and alphanumeric • Adjustable contrast Connectors • RJ-11 interface jack for telephone • RJ-11 interface jack for Group 3 analog fax • DB-9 port for GPRS or circuit switched digital PC fax/data •DIN connector for PC keyboard • TNC antenna connector (50 ohms) • DC power input jack Antenna • Dipole antenna (included) GSM 900/1800: 2 dBi dual band GSM 1900: 2 dBi single band • Optional higher gain antennas available AC-to-DC Switching Power Supply (Included) • Voltage: 90 - 300 VAC • Frequency: 50/60 Hz • Plug options: U.S., U.K., Euro., Australia Emergency Battery Backup • 4 “AA” alkaline batteries provide up to 1 hour of air time. (Batteries not included.) External Battery Backup (Optional) • External battery backup unit/charger (provides up to 8 hours of air time or 14 hours of standby) Phonecell ® SX5D Copyright ©2002 Telular Corporation, all rights reserved. MPE CALCULATION The MPE calculation for Telular (EIRP = 32 dBm) @ 20cm: P = E 2 / 120*pi = { 32 (field strength@1meter) +20log(1/0.2) (distance correction factor for 0.2 meter)} 2 /120*pi = { 32 (dBm) +14 dB(distance correction factor for 0.2 meter)} 2 /120*pi = { 46 (dBm) } 2 /120*pi = { 45 (V/m) } 2 /120*pi = (45 x 45)/376.6 = 5.38 W/m 2 *P is power density in W/m 2 and E is field strength in V/m *The power density P =5.38 W/m 2 is less than 10 W/m 2 (listed MPE limit)
